+/*
+ * drivers/watchdog/m54xx_wdt.c
+ *
+ * Watchdog driver for ColdFire MCF547x & MCF548x processors
+ * Copyright 2010 (c) Philippe De Muyter <phdm@macqel.be>
+ *
+ * Adapted from the IXP4xx watchdog driver, which carries these notices:
+ *
+ *  Author: Deepak Saxena <dsaxena@plexity.net>
+ *
+ *  Copyright 2004 (c) MontaVista, Software, Inc.
+ *  Based on sa1100 driver, Copyright (C) 2000 Oleg Drokin <green@crimea.edu>
+ *
+ * This file is licensed under  the terms of the GNU General Public
+ * License version 2. This program is licensed "as is" without any
+ * warranty of any kind, whether express or implied.
+ */
+
+#include <linux/module.h>
+#include <linux/moduleparam.h>
+#include <linux/types.h>
+#include <linux/kernel.h>
+#include <linux/fs.h>
+#include <linux/miscdevice.h>
+#include <linux/watchdog.h>
+#include <linux/init.h>
+#include <linux/bitops.h>
+#include <linux/ioport.h>
+#include <linux/uaccess.h>
+
+#include <asm/coldfire.h>
+#include <asm/m54xxsim.h>
+#include <asm/m54xxgpt.h>
+
+static int nowayout = WATCHDOG_NOWAYOUT;
+static unsigned int heartbeat = 30;    /* (secs) Default is 0.5 minute */
+static unsigned long wdt_status;
+
+#define        WDT_IN_USE              0
+#define        WDT_OK_TO_CLOSE         1
+
+static void wdt_enable(void)
+{
+       unsigned int gms0;
+
+       /* preserve GPIO usage, if any */
+       gms0 = __raw_readl(MCF_MBAR + MCF_GPT_GMS0);
+       if (gms0 & MCF_GPT_GMS_TMS_GPIO)
+               gms0 &= (MCF_GPT_GMS_TMS_GPIO | MCF_GPT_GMS_GPIO_MASK
+                                                       | MCF_GPT_GMS_OD);
+       else
+               gms0 = MCF_GPT_GMS_TMS_GPIO | MCF_GPT_GMS_OD;
+       __raw_writel(gms0, MCF_MBAR + MCF_GPT_GMS0);
+       __raw_writel(MCF_GPT_GCIR_PRE(heartbeat*(MCF_BUSCLK/0xffff)) |
+                       MCF_GPT_GCIR_CNT(0xffff), MCF_MBAR + MCF_GPT_GCIR0);
+       gms0 |= MCF_GPT_GMS_OCPW(0xA5) | MCF_GPT_GMS_WDEN | MCF_GPT_GMS_CE;
+       __raw_writel(gms0, MCF_MBAR + MCF_GPT_GMS0);
+}
+
+static void wdt_disable(void)
+{
+       unsigned int gms0;
+
+       /* disable watchdog */
+       gms0 = __raw_readl(MCF_MBAR + MCF_GPT_GMS0);
+       gms0 &= ~(MCF_GPT_GMS_WDEN | MCF_GPT_GMS_CE);
+       __raw_writel(gms0, MCF_MBAR + MCF_GPT_GMS0);
+}
+
+static void wdt_keepalive(void)
+{
+       unsigned int gms0;
+
+       gms0 = __raw_readl(MCF_MBAR + MCF_GPT_GMS0);
+       gms0 |= MCF_GPT_GMS_OCPW(0xA5);
+       __raw_writel(gms0, MCF_MBAR + MCF_GPT_GMS0);
+}
+
+static int m54xx_wdt_open(struct inode *inode, struct file *file)
+{
+       if (test_and_set_bit(WDT_IN_USE, &wdt_status))
+               return -EBUSY;
+
+       clear_bit(WDT_OK_TO_CLOSE, &wdt_status);
+       wdt_enable();
+       return nonseekable_open(inode, file);
+}
+
+static ssize_t m54xx_wdt_write(struct file *file, const char *data,
+                                               size_t len, loff_t *ppos)
+{
+       if (len) {
+               if (!nowayout) {
+                       size_t i;
+
+                       clear_bit(WDT_OK_TO_CLOSE, &wdt_status);
+
+                       for (i = 0; i != len; i++) {
+                               char c;
+
+                               if (get_user(c, data + i))
+                                       return -EFAULT;
+                               if (c == 'V')
+                                       set_bit(WDT_OK_TO_CLOSE, &wdt_status);
+                       }
+               }
+               wdt_keepalive();
+       }
+       return len;
+}
+
+static const struct watchdog_info ident = {
+       .options        = WDIOF_MAGICCLOSE | WDIOF_SETTIMEOUT |
+                               WDIOF_KEEPALIVEPING,
+       .identity       = "Coldfire M54xx Watchdog",
+};
+
+static long m54xx_wdt_ioctl(struct file *file, unsigned int cmd,
+                                                        unsigned long arg)
+{
+       int ret = -ENOTTY;
+       int time;
+
+       switch (cmd) {
+       case WDIOC_GETSUPPORT:
+               ret = copy_to_user((struct watchdog_info *)arg, &ident,
+                                  sizeof(ident)) ? -EFAULT : 0;
+               break;
+
+       case WDIOC_GETSTATUS:
+               ret = put_user(0, (int *)arg);
+               break;
+
+       case WDIOC_GETBOOTSTATUS:
+               ret = put_user(0, (int *)arg);
+               break;
+
+       case WDIOC_KEEPALIVE:
+               wdt_keepalive();
+               ret = 0;
+               break;
+
+       case WDIOC_SETTIMEOUT:
+               ret = get_user(time, (int *)arg);
+               if (ret)
+                       break;
+
+               if (time <= 0 || time > 30) {
+                       ret = -EINVAL;
+                       break;
+               }
+
+               heartbeat = time;
+               wdt_enable();
+               /* Fall through */
+
+       case WDIOC_GETTIMEOUT:
+               ret = put_user(heartbeat, (int *)arg);
+               break;
+       }
+       return ret;
+}
+
+static int m54xx_wdt_release(struct inode *inode, struct file *file)
+{
+       if (test_bit(WDT_OK_TO_CLOSE, &wdt_status))
+               wdt_disable();
+       else {
+               printk(KERN_CRIT "WATCHDOG: Device closed unexpectedly - "
+                                       "timer will not stop\n");
+               wdt_keepalive();
+       }
+       clear_bit(WDT_IN_USE, &wdt_status);
+       clear_bit(WDT_OK_TO_CLOSE, &wdt_status);
+
+       return 0;
+}
+
+
+static const struct file_operations m54xx_wdt_fops = {
+       .owner          = THIS_MODULE,
+       .llseek         = no_llseek,
+       .write          = m54xx_wdt_write,
+       .unlocked_ioctl = m54xx_wdt_ioctl,
+       .open           = m54xx_wdt_open,
+       .release        = m54xx_wdt_release,
+};
+
+static struct miscdevice m54xx_wdt_miscdev = {
+       .minor          = WATCHDOG_MINOR,
+       .name           = "watchdog",
+       .fops           = &m54xx_wdt_fops,
+};
+
+static int __init m54xx_wdt_init(void)
+{
+       if (!request_mem_region(MCF_MBAR + MCF_GPT_GCIR0, 4,
+                                               "Coldfire M54xx Watchdog")) {
+               printk(KERN_WARNING
+                               "Coldfire M54xx Watchdog : I/O region busy\n");
+               return -EBUSY;
+       }
+       printk(KERN_INFO "ColdFire watchdog driver is loaded.\n");
+
+       return misc_register(&m54xx_wdt_miscdev);
+}
+
+static void __exit m54xx_wdt_exit(void)
+{
+       misc_deregister(&m54xx_wdt_miscdev);
+       release_mem_region(MCF_MBAR + MCF_GPT_GCIR0, 4);
+}
+
+module_init(m54xx_wdt_init);
+module_exit(m54xx_wdt_exit);
+
+MODULE_AUTHOR("Philippe De Muyter <phdm@macqel.be>");
+MODULE_DESCRIPTION("Coldfire M54xx Watchdog");
+
+module_param(heartbeat, int, 0);
+MODULE_PARM_DESC(heartbeat, "Watchdog heartbeat in seconds (default 30s)");
+
+module_param(nowayout, int, 0);
+MODULE_PARM_DESC(nowayout, "Watchdog cannot be stopped once started");
+
+MODULE_LICENSE("GPL");
+MODULE_ALIAS_MISCDEV(WATCHDOG_MINOR);
